A novel HLA-DRB1 allele, DRB1*1219, was identified by sequence-based typing in a Chinese leukaemia family |

Abstract: | ![]() A novel human leukocyte antigen DRB1 allele, DRB1*1219, has been identified in a Chinese leukaemia patient and his family by polymerase chain reaction sequence-based typing, which has one nucleotide change at position 341 (C→T) in exon 2 from the closest matching allele DRB1*120201, resulting in an amino acid substitution from Ala→Val at codon 85. |
